Ferroelasticity, thermochromism, semi-conductivity, and ferromagnetism in a new layered perovskite: (4-fluorophenethylaminium)<sub>2</sub>[CuCl<sub>4</sub>]
Ya-Ping Gong, Xiao‐Xian Chen, Guo‐Zhang Huang, Wei‐Xiong Zhang, Xiao‐Ming Chen
Abstract
A new A 2 BX 4 -type layered perovskite, (4-fluorophenethylaminium) 2 [CuCl 4 ], exhibits multi-channel properties including above-room-temperature ferroelasticity, reversible thermochromism, indirect semi-conductivity, and low-temperature ferromagnetism.
